Electrical behavior and pore accumulation in a multicellular model for conventional and supra-electroporation
Extremely large but very short (20 kV/cm, 300 nanosecond) electric field pulses were reported recently to non-thermally destroy melanoma tumors. The stated mechanism for field penetration into cells is pulse characteristic times faster than charge redistribution (displacement currents). Here we use...
